Sony x The Boys: VR Stealth Action Video Game to Launch Soon
Sony and ARVORE announce The Boys: Trigger Warning, marking the franchise’s first VR entry as pre-orders open.
- The Boys is about to release a Sony-backed VR stealth-action video game in 2026.
- Players will team up with The Boys to fight Vought’s corruption.
- Key cast members reportedly return in the game, with creators helping to shape the game’s dark humor and style.
The Boys series is venturing into gaming with the release of The Boys: Trigger Warning. The VR stealth-action title, revealed on December 8, 2025, is being developed by ARVORE, a Brazilian studio, in collaboration with Sony Pictures Virtual Reality. The video game is set to be released in 2026 on PS VR2 and Meta Quest, with pre-orders now being available at a special price of $23.99 USD.
The Boys: Trigger Warning players would assume the role of a fresh character as part of the gameplay, who discovers a chilling secret related to Vought International. After being unwillingly transformed into a “Supe,” the protagonist teams up with The Boys to take on Vought from within. The task is carried out through a combination of stealth, violence, and the franchise's trademark dark comedy.
The Boys VR Game: Returning Cast & Support from the Show’s Creative Team
Many TV series cast members will reprise their roles in the VR game, including Laz Alonso (Mother's Milk), Colby Minifie (Ashley Barrett), and P.J. Byrne (Adam Bourke). Jensen Ackles is also returning as Soldier Boy, but in a darker, game-exclusive version of the character.
According to developer ARVORE, the game was created in close collaboration with the show's creators, writers, and producers. Sony Pictures Entertainment senior vice president Lance Sloane said, “Having the show’s creators involved in shaping the experience allows us to push the boundaries of immersive storytelling, and we’re grateful to collaborate with our friends at Meta and PlayStation to deliver it to fans.”
As per other industry reports, Founder Ricardo Justus said, “Working with the show’s writers and cast allowed us to bring the edge, humor, and brutality that made the series iconic, delivered with the spark of magic only ARVORE can create.”
With virtual reality becoming more prevalent in mainstream gaming, The Boys: Trigger Warning is a daring shift for the franchise. The Amazon series continues to have a significant cultural impact. Its fourth season drew more than 55 million viewers globally, with certain regions reporting demand that was over 18 times higher than any average TV show.
